About cyclohexa-2,6-diene-1,2-diamine;ethane

cyclohexa-2,6-diene-1,2-diamine;ethane (PubChem CID 143733519) has the molecular formula C8H16N2 and a molecular weight of 140.23 g/mol. Its IUPAC name is cyclohexa-2,6-diene-1,2-diamine;ethane.
